Step-by-step explanation:
The student has asked for the next step in the equation solving sequence for the equation 7y = 49 - 7. The initial stage in solving this linear equation is to simplify the right-hand side of the equation by performing the subtraction. From there, we can isolate the variable y to find its value.
The next step would be to subtract 7 from 49, which simplifies the equation to 7y = 42. Then, to solve for y, we divide both sides of the equation by 7, resulting in y = 6. This provides us with the value of y.
Simplifying equations and isolating the variable are fundamental concepts in algebra, and understanding them can help in solving more complex problems.
To check the answer, we can substitute the value of y back into the original equation to ensure that the left-hand side equals the right-hand side.
